How much does a Project Controls Manager make in United Kingdom?
£39,000/ Annual
Based on 10000 salaries
The average Project Controls Manager in United Kingdom is £39,000 per year or £20 per hour. Entry-level positions start at £28,117 per year, while most experienced workers make up to £54,000 per year.
